If a plane can travel 490 miles per hour with the wind and 430 miles per hour against the​ wind, find the speed of the plane in still air.

Answer:

460

Explanation:

Let b = base speed and w = wind power.

Here's what we know:

b + w = 490

b - w = 430

From here, we can use the elimination method. If we treat each variable and constant as columns, we do the following:

b + b = 2b

w - w = 0

490 + 430 = 920

Leaving us with:

2b = 920

Divide by 2:

2b / 2 = b

920 / 2 = 460

So b = 460 mph
